The Core Pillars of an SEO Agency's Tech Stack
An efficient SEO method relies on numerous unique yet interconnected activities. High-performing firms usually categorize their software application requires into 4 main pillars:
1. All-in-One SEO Suites
These platforms act as the "Swiss Army Knife" for digital online marketers. They use a broad range of features, consisting of keyword research, competitor analysis, and site auditing. For an agency, these tools are important for high-level technique and daily monitoring.
2. Technical SEO and Crawling Tools
While all-in-one suites have auditing functions, specialized spiders are needed for deep-dive technical analysis. These tools help firms identify broken links, crawl mistakes, replicate content, and concerns with site architecture that might be undetectable to more generalized software.
3. Rank Tracking and Reporting
Customer retention depends greatly on openness. Agencies need software that can track keyword positions throughout different geolocations and gadgets, then equate that information into professional, easy-to-digest reports.
4. Backlink Analysis and Outreach
Off-page SEO remains a vital ranking factor. Software in this category permits firms to monitor their clients' link profiles, evaluate rivals' link-building techniques, and handle outreach projects to secure premium backlinks.

The Role of Reporting and Data Visualization One of the biggest difficulties for an SEO agency is interacting the worth of technical work to a non-technical customer.Reporting software bridges this gap. While tools like Semrush supply built-in reports, many companies choose devoted visualization platforms.Looker Studio(formerly Google Data Studio)is the market requirement free of charge, highly customizable reporting. By using"adapters," agencies can pull data from Google Search Console, Google Analytics, and numerous SEO tools into a single, interactive control panel. Other premium alternatives like AgencyAnalytics or DashThis provide a more automated experience, incorporating social networks, PPC, and SEO information into one lovely
interface, conserving account managers hours of manual data entry every month. transitioning to Semrush or Ahrefs is advised. Can an agency rely solely on totally free tools? While it is possible to carry out SEO using just totally free tools(Google Search Console, Analytics, and Keyword Planner),

it is not scalable. Free tools frequently lack competitor analysis, automated reporting,and bulk processing capabilities, which are essential for managing multiple clients effectively. Howmuch should an agency invest on software application? Usually, a small to mid-sized agency may invest in between ₤ 300and ₤ 1,000 per month on a core tech stack. Enterprise companies with customized API requires and large-scale crawling requirements can quickly invest upwards of ₤ 5,000 per month.Why is backlink software crucial for companies? Backlinks remain a top-three ranking element.
Agencies require software to determine"poisonous"links that could lead to charges, discover unlinked brand name mentions, and discoverwhich websites are linking to a client's competitors.
